The legal and ethical frameworks around AI consciousness are becoming a bigger part of the plot. Is a conscious AI a person? Does it have rights? Who is liable for its actions? Recent novels like 'The Actual Star' or 'The Space Between Worlds' (tangentially) weave these questions into their world-building, showing societies struggling to update their laws and morals for a new type of being. It's the boring, crucial detail that makes it feel real.

The relationship between consciousness and purpose is central. If an AI is built for a specific task (security, caregiving, analysis), how does achieving consciousness change its relationship to that purpose? Does it embrace it, reject it, or reinterpret it? This internal conflict is a rich source of character development, turning a tool into a protagonist with agency and conflict.

Neal Stephenson's 'Fall; or, Dodge in Hell' dives headfirst into digital immortality and consciousness uploads. After a tech billionaire's brain is scanned, a digital afterlife is created, evolving into its own reality. The book splits between the real world and the chaotic, mythologically-tinged digital realm. It's a massive, sometimes messy, but always ambitious take on what happens when consciousness becomes software and the politics of who controls that new frontier.

Don't forget the comedic takes! There's a whole subgenre of sci-fi where the AI is fully conscious, incredibly powerful, and just... deeply bored or petty. Its interactions with humans are driven by a desire for entertainment or minor grievances. It might hold a planet hostage because it didn't like the ending of a streaming series, or it could be a miserably pedantic librarian AI. This approach humanizes machine consciousness through flawed, relatable emotions rather than grand cosmic purpose. It’s a fun reminder that superintelligence might not automatically mean wisdom or benevolence—it could just mean being a super-powered annoyance.

If we’re including graphic novels, 'The Incal' by Alejandro Jodorowsky and Moebius is a psychedelic epic where consciousness, the universe, and meta-reality are all connected. The hero, John DiFool, is a lowly detective thrown into a cosmic struggle involving the divine essence of the universe itself. It’s a visually stunning, mind-bending exploration of collective unconscious, enlightenment, and the nature of reality as a dream. Deeply influential on everything from 'The Fifth Element' to modern comics.
